Written By: 川俣 晶
Blazor WebAssemblyでToString("C");が不適切な文字列を返す (円記号を用いた日本の通貨表示ではない)
なお、カルチャは以下のようにプログラムの最初で設定済みである。
var cult = System.Globalization.CultureInfo.CreateSpecificCulture("ja-JP");
System.Threading.Thread.CurrentThread.CurrentCulture = cult;
デスクトップアプリ/サーバアプリの時には同じコードで円記号が出ていた。
不明。
(どうもBlazor WebAssemblyの場合は、実行している途中で設定してあったカルチャ情報がどこかに消えてしまうっぽい)
カルチャ情報を使用する直前にカルチャ情報を設定する。つまり、ToString("C");の直前に設定コードを実行させる。
[メッセージ送信フォームを利用する]
メッセージ送信フォームを利用することで、川俣 晶に対してメッセージを送ることができます。
この機能は、100%確実に川俣 晶へメッセージを伝達するものではなく、また、確実に川俣 晶よりの返事を得られるものではないことにご注意ください。
管理者: 川俣 晶
Powered by MagSite2 Version 0.36 (Alpha-Test) Copyright (c) 2004-2021 Pie Dey.Co.,Ltd.